Output f3437afeaafe44a84d3237f31406341eb9cdf582add10abbc330ae4e416a9f6b:1

value
2216091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fe29d91e8031adc748dfb99be46e36a56c5dbf5 OP_EQUAL
address
3KBcThqSD8mbB21f8VKZgp1sazzdaoBcTz
transaction
f3437afeaafe44a84d3237f31406341eb9cdf582add10abbc330ae4e416a9f6b
confirmations
312188
spent
true